技术博客
Windows操作系统上MySQL 8.0安装与启动全攻略

Windows操作系统上MySQL 8.0安装与启动全攻略

作者: 万维易源
2024-11-27
MySQL安装启动Windows
### 摘要 本文旨在介绍在Windows操作系统上安装并启动MySQL 8.0版本的简洁步骤。通过详细的步骤说明,读者可以轻松地完成MySQL的安装和启动,从而为数据库管理和开发提供强大的支持。 ### 关键词 MySQL, 安装, 启动, Windows, 8.0 ## 一、MySQL 8.0的安装过程 ### 1.1 MySQL 8.0简介及在Windows上的应用场景 MySQL 8.0 是目前最流行的开源关系型数据库管理系统之一,以其高性能、可靠性和易用性而闻名。作为一款广泛应用于企业级应用和互联网服务的数据库系统,MySQL 8.0 在功能和性能方面都有了显著的提升。在Windows操作系统上安装MySQL 8.0,不仅可以为个人开发者提供强大的数据管理工具,还可以为企业级应用提供稳定的数据支持。无论是用于网站后端、数据分析还是其他数据密集型应用,MySQL 8.0 都是一个理想的选择。 ### 1.2 安装前的准备工作 在开始安装MySQL 8.0之前,确保您的Windows操作系统满足以下基本要求: - **操作系统版本**:Windows 7 SP1 或更高版本 - **硬件要求**:至少1 GB的RAM,建议2 GB或以上 - **磁盘空间**:至少200 MB的可用磁盘空间,建议500 MB或以上 - **网络连接**:确保您的计算机能够访问互联网,以便下载安装包和更新 此外,建议关闭所有正在运行的应用程序,以避免安装过程中出现冲突。如果您已经在您的系统上安装了其他版本的MySQL,请确保卸载这些旧版本,以避免版本冲突。 ### 1.3 下载MySQL 8.0安装包 访问MySQL官方网站(https://dev.mysql.com/downloads/mysql/),选择适合您操作系统的MySQL 8.0版本。推荐下载 **MySQL Community Edition**,这是免费且功能齐全的版本,适用于大多数开发和生产环境。点击“Download”按钮,选择适合您操作系统的安装包(例如,Windows (x86, 64-bit), ZIP Archive)。下载完成后,将安装包保存到一个易于访问的文件夹中。 ### 1.4 安装MySQL 8.0 Community Edition 1. **解压安装包**:如果下载的是ZIP格式的安装包,将其解压到一个指定的文件夹中。如果是安装程序(如msi文件),直接双击运行。 2. **启动安装向导**:运行安装程序后,会弹出MySQL Installer向导。选择“Custom”安装类型,以便自定义安装选项。 3. **选择产品**:在“Select Products and Features”页面,选择“MySQL Server 8.0.x”和“MySQL Workbench”,然后点击“Next”。 4. **配置安装路径**:选择合适的安装路径,建议保持默认路径,除非有特殊需求。 5. **开始安装**:点击“Execute”按钮,开始安装过程。安装过程中可能会提示您输入管理员密码,按照提示操作即可。 6. **完成安装**:安装完成后,点击“Finish”按钮,进入下一步配置。 ### 1.5 配置MySQL服务器 1. **启动MySQL配置向导**:安装完成后,打开MySQL Installer,选择“Reconfigure”选项,启动MySQL配置向导。 2. **选择配置类型**:选择“Detailed Configuration”,以便进行更详细的设置。 3. **选择服务器类型**:根据您的实际需求选择服务器类型,例如“Developer Machine”、“Server Machine”或“Dedicated MySQL Server Machine”。 4. **选择InnoDB配置**:选择合适的InnoDB配置,通常选择“Production”选项。 5. **设置端口和字符集**:默认端口为3306,字符集建议选择“utf8mb4”,以支持更多的字符编码。 6. **设置root用户密码**:设置MySQL root用户的密码,确保密码强度足够高,以保障数据库的安全。 7. **完成配置**:点击“Execute”按钮,完成配置过程。配置完成后,MySQL服务器将自动启动。 ### 1.6 安装MySQL Workbench MySQL Workbench 是一个强大的图形化管理工具,可以帮助您更方便地管理和操作MySQL数据库。安装步骤如下: 1. **启动MySQL Installer**:打开MySQL Installer,选择“Add”选项,添加新的组件。 2. **选择MySQL Workbench**:在“Select Products and Features”页面,选择“MySQL Workbench”。 3. **开始安装**:点击“Next”按钮,然后点击“Execute”按钮,开始安装MySQL Workbench。 4. **完成安装**:安装完成后,点击“Finish”按钮,启动MySQL Workbench。 5. **连接到MySQL服务器**:在MySQL Workbench中,点击“+”按钮,创建一个新的连接。输入服务器地址(localhost)、用户名(root)和密码,点击“Test Connection”按钮测试连接是否成功。连接成功后,点击“OK”按钮保存连接信息。 通过以上步骤,您可以在Windows操作系统上成功安装并启动MySQL 8.0,为您的数据库管理和开发提供强大的支持。希望本文对您有所帮助,祝您在数据库管理的道路上越走越远! ## 二、启动MySQL并初步配置 ### 2.1 启动MySQL服务的步骤 在完成MySQL 8.0的安装和配置后,接下来的重要一步是启动MySQL服务。这一步骤确保MySQL服务器能够在您的Windows系统上正常运行,为您的应用程序提供稳定的数据支持。以下是启动MySQL服务的具体步骤: 1. **打开服务管理器**:按下 `Win + R` 键,输入 `services.msc`,然后按回车键。这将打开Windows服务管理器。 2. **找到MySQL服务**:在服务列表中,找到名为 `MySQL80` 的服务。如果您在安装过程中自定义了服务名称,请查找相应的服务名称。 3. **启动MySQL服务**:右键点击 `MySQL80` 服务,选择“启动”。如果服务已经处于运行状态,您可以选择“重新启动”以确保服务的最新配置生效。 4. **检查服务状态**:启动服务后,确保其状态显示为“正在运行”。如果遇到任何问题,可以查看MySQL的日志文件以获取更多信息。 ### 2.2 使用命令行管理MySQL服务 除了通过服务管理器启动和管理MySQL服务外,您还可以使用命令行工具来执行这些操作。这对于自动化脚本和高级管理任务非常有用。以下是使用命令行管理MySQL服务的步骤: 1. **打开命令提示符**:按下 `Win + R` 键,输入 `cmd`,然后按回车键。这将打开命令提示符窗口。 2. **启动MySQL服务**:在命令提示符中输入以下命令并按回车键: ```sh net start MySQL80 ``` 3. **停止MySQL服务**:如果需要停止MySQL服务,可以输入以下命令并按回车键: ```sh net stop MySQL80 ``` 4. **重启MySQL服务**:如果需要重启MySQL服务,可以输入以下命令并按回车键: ```sh net stop MySQL80 && net start MySQL80 ``` ### 2.3 设置root用户密码 为了确保MySQL服务器的安全性,设置root用户的密码是非常重要的。在安装过程中,您可能已经设置了root用户的初始密码。如果需要更改或重置密码,可以按照以下步骤操作: 1. **打开命令提示符**:按下 `Win + R` 键,输入 `cmd`,然后按回车键。 2. **登录MySQL**:在命令提示符中输入以下命令并按回车键,使用当前的root用户密码登录: ```sh mysql -u root -p ``` 输入密码后,您将进入MySQL命令行界面。 3. **更改root用户密码**:在MySQL命令行界面中,输入以下命令并按回车键,设置新的root用户密码: ```sql 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码'; ``` 将 `新密码` 替换为您想要设置的新密码。 4. **刷新权限**:输入以下命令并按回车键,刷新权限以使更改生效: ```sql FLUSH PRIVILEGES; ``` 5. **退出MySQL**:输入以下命令并按回车键,退出MySQL命令行界面: ```sql exit; ``` ### 2.4 连接到MySQL服务器 成功安装和配置MySQL 8.0后,您可以通过多种方式连接到MySQL服务器。以下是使用命令行和MySQL Workbench连接到MySQL服务器的方法: #### 使用命令行连接 1. **打开命令提示符**:按下 `Win + R` 键,输入 `cmd`,然后按回车键。 2. **连接到MySQL**:在命令提示符中输入以下命令并按回车键,使用root用户和密码连接到MySQL服务器: ```sh mysql -u root -p ``` 输入密码后,您将进入MySQL命令行界面。 #### 使用MySQL Workbench连接 1. **启动MySQL Workbench**:在开始菜单中找到MySQL Workbench并启动。 2. **创建新的连接**:在MySQL Workbench主界面中,点击左下角的“+”按钮,创建一个新的连接。 3. **配置连接信息**:在弹出的对话框中,输入以下信息: - **连接名称**:自定义连接名称,例如“Local MySQL”。 - **连接方法**:选择“Standard (TCP/IP)”。 - **主机名**:输入 `localhost`。 - **端口**:输入 `3306`。 - **用户名**:输入 `root`。 - **密码**:点击“Store in Vault...”按钮,输入并存储root用户的密码。 4. **测试连接**:点击“Test Connection”按钮,测试连接是否成功。如果连接成功,点击“OK”按钮保存连接信息。 5. **连接到MySQL**:在MySQL Workbench主界面中,双击刚刚创建的连接,即可连接到MySQL服务器。 通过以上步骤,您可以在Windows操作系统上成功启动并连接到MySQL 8.0,为您的数据库管理和开发提供强大的支持。希望本文对您有所帮助,祝您在数据库管理的道路上越走越远! ## 三、总结 通过本文的详细步骤,读者可以轻松地在Windows操作系统上安装并启动MySQL 8.0版本。从下载安装包到配置MySQL服务器,再到启动服务和连接到MySQL,每一步都提供了清晰的操作指南。MySQL 8.0不仅具备高性能和可靠性,还提供了丰富的功能,适用于各种数据管理和开发场景。无论是个人开发者还是企业用户,都可以通过本文的指导,顺利地完成MySQL 8.0的安装和配置,为数据库管理和开发提供强大的支持。希望本文能帮助您在数据库管理的道路上越走越远,实现更高的技术目标。
加载文章中...